Piering services involve the process of stabilizing and leveling a building’s foundation by installing support piers beneath the structure. These piers are typically made of steel or concrete and are driven deep into the ground to reach stable soil layers. Once in place, they lift and support the foundation, helping to restore its proper position. This method is often used in cases where the foundation has shifted or settled unevenly, causing structural issues or cracks in walls and floors. By reinforcing the foundation from below, piering can provide a long-term solution to foundation instability.
This service is particularly effective in addressing problems caused by soil movement, such as expansive clay or shifting earth, which can lead to uneven settling of a property’s foundation. Signs that indicate piering might be needed include noticeable cracks in walls, uneven floors, sticking doors or windows, and gaps around window frames. When these issues appear, it often points to a foundation that has shifted or settled unevenly over time. Piering helps to correct these problems by providing solid support beneath the foundation, preventing further movement and potential structural damage.

What is piering service used for? Piering service is used to stabilize and lift settling or uneven foundations by installing supports beneath the structure.
How do local contractors perform piering work? Contractors assess the foundation, then install piers or supports beneath the affected areas to restore stability and alignment.
Can piering fix foundation issues caused by soil movement? Yes, piering is effective in addressing foundation problems related to soil shifting or settling by providing additional support.
What types of piers are commonly used in piering services? Common types include push piers, helical piers, and slab piers, each suited for different foundation and soil conditions.
